Output 0870d931b93b27112f0d6a386dd6139fd8fead4261063d5fdf55b33ab441fa81:1

value
638000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54acf5d3095bcb63069e5fd9d0aac6ccc7b226bd OP_EQUAL
address
39Qjt9SwMYzndsQXNCCRdxjF1mxfqjHMRN
transaction
0870d931b93b27112f0d6a386dd6139fd8fead4261063d5fdf55b33ab441fa81
confirmations
503312
spent
true